Big video data could change how we do everything — from catching bad guys to tracking shoppers


Sean Varah at VentureBeat: “Everyone takes pictures and video with their devices. Parents record their kids’ soccer games, companies record employee training, police surveillance cameras at busy intersections run 24/7, and drones monitor pipelines in the desert.
With vast amounts of video growing vaster at a rate faster than the day before, and the hottest devices like drones decreasing in price and size until everyone has one (OK, not in their pocket quite yet) it’s time to start talking about mining this mass of valuable video data for useful purposes.
Julian Mann, the cofounder of Skybox Imaging — a company in the business of commercial satellite imagery and the developer advocate for Google Earth outreach — says that the new “Skybox for Good” program will provide “a constantly updated model of change of the entire planet” with the potential to “save lives, protect the environment, promote education, and positively impact humanity.”…
Mining video data through “man + machine” artificial intelligence is new technology in search of unsolved problems. Could this be the next chapter in the ever-evolving technology revolution?
For the past 50 years, satellite imagery has only been available to the U.S. intelligence community and those countries with technology to launch their own. Digital Globe was one of the first companies to make satellite imagery available commercially, and now Skybox and a few others have joined them. Drones are even newer, having been used by the U.S. military since the ‘90s for surveillance over battlefields or, in this age of counter-terrorism, playing the role of aerial detectives finding bad guys in the middle of nowhere. Before drones, the same tasks required thousands of troops on the ground, putting many young men and women in harm’s way. Today, hundreds of trained “eyes” safely located here in the U.S. watch hours of video from a single drone to assess current situations in countries far away….”

The Paradox of Openness


New Book on Transparency and Participation in Nordic Cultures of Consensus, edited by Norbert Götz, Södertörn University, and Carl Marklund, Södertörn University: “The ‘open society’ has become a watchword of liberal democracy and the market system in the modern globalized world. Openness stands for individual opportunity and collective reason, as well as bottom-up empowerment and top-down transparency. It has become a cherished value, despite its vagueness and the connotation of vulnerability that surrounds it. Scandinavia has long considered itself a model of openness, citing traditions of freedom of information and inclusive policy making. This collection of essays traces the conceptual origins, development, and diverse challenges of openness in the Nordic countries and Austria. It examines some of the many paradoxes that openness encounters and the tensions it arouses when it addresses such divergent ends as democratic deliberation and market transactions, freedom of speech and sensitive information, compliant decision making and political and administrative transparency, and consensual procedures and the toleration of dissent.”

Show Me the Evidence


New book by Ron Haskins: “This book tells the story of how the Obama administration planned and enacted several initiatives to fund social programs based on rigorous evidence of success and thereby created a fundamental change in the role of evidence in federal policymaking.
Using interviews with the major players from the White House, the Office of Management and Budget, federal agencies, Congress, and the child advocacy community, the authors detail the development and implementation of six evidence-based social policy initiatives by the Obama administration.
The initiatives range widely over fundamental issues in the nation’s social policy including preschool and K-12 education, teen pregnancy, employment and training, health, and community-based programs. These initiatives constitute a revolution in the use of social science evidence to guide federal policymaking and the operation of federal grant programs.
A fascinating story for everyone interested in politics and policy, this book also provides a blueprint for policymakers worldwide who are interested in expanding the use of evidence in policy.

Selected Readings on Cities and Civic Technology


By Julia Root and Stefaan Verhulst

The Living Library’s Selected Readings series seeks to build a knowledge base on innovative approaches for improving the effectiveness and legitimacy of governance. This curated and annotated collection of recommended works on the topic of civic innovation was originally published in 2014.

The last five years have seen a wave of new organizations, entrepreneurs and investment in cities and the field of civic innovation.  Two subfields, Civic Tech and Government Innovation, are particularly aligned with GovLab’s interest in the ways in which technology is and can be deployed to redesign public institutions and re-imagine governance.

The emerging field of civic technology, or “Civic Tech,” champions new digital platforms, open data and collaboration tools for transforming government service delivery and engagement with citizens. Government Innovation, while not a new field, has seen in the last five years a proliferation of new structures (e.g. Mayor’s Office of New Urban Mechanics), roles (e.g. Chief Technology/Innovation Officer) and public/private investment (e.g. Innovation Delivery Teams and Code for America Fellows) that are building a world-wide movement for transforming how government thinks about and designs services for its citizens.

There is no set definition for “civic innovation.” However, broadly speaking, it is about improving our cities through the implementation of tools, ideas and engagement methods that strengthen the relationship between government and citizens. The civic innovation field encompasses diverse actors from across the public, private and nonprofit spectrums. These can include government leaders, nonprofit and foundation professionals, urbanists, technologists, researchers, business leaders and community organizers, each of whom may use the term in a different way, but ultimately are seeking to disrupt how cities and public institutions solve problems and invest in solutions.

Selected Reading List (in alphabetical order)

Annotated Selected Readings (in alphabetical order)

Books

Goldsmith, Stephen, and Susan Crawford. The Responsive City: Engaging Communities Through Data-Smart Governance. 1 edition. San Francisco, CA: Jossey-Bass, 2014. http://bit.ly/1zvKOL0.

  • The Responsive City, a guide to civic engagement and governance in the digital age, is the culmination of research originating from the Data-Smart City Solutions initiative, an ongoing project at Harvard Kennedy School working to catalyze adoption of data projects on the city level.
  • The “data smart city” is one that is responsive to citizens, engages them in problem solving and finds new innovative solutions for dismantling entrenched bureaucracy.
  • The authors document case studies from New York City, Boston and Chicago to explore the following topics:
    • Building trust in the public sector and fostering a sustained, collective voice among communities;
    • Using data-smart governance to preempt and predict problems while improving quality of life;
    • Creating efficiencies and saving taxpayer money with digital tools; and
    • Spearheading these new approaches to government with innovative leadership.

Townsend, Anthony M. Smart Cities: Big Data, Civic Hackers, and the Quest for a New Utopia. 1 edition. New York: W. W. Norton & Company, 2013. http://bit.ly/17Y4G0R.

  • In this book, Townsend illustrates how “cities worldwide are deploying technology to address both the timeless challenges of government and the mounting problems posed by human settlements of previously unimaginable size and complexity.”
  • He also considers “the motivations, aspirations, and shortcomings” of the many stakeholders involved in the development of smart cities, and poses a new civics to guide these efforts.
  • He argues that smart cities are not made smart by various, soon-to-be-obsolete technologies built into its infrastructure; instead, it is how citizens are using ever-changing and grassroots technologies to be “human-centered, inclusive and resilient” that will make cities ‘smart.’

Reports + Journal Articles

Black, Alissa, and Rachel Burstein. “The 2050 City – What Civic Innovation Looks Like Today and Tomorrow.” White Paper. New America Foundation – California Civic Innovation Project, June 2013. https://bit.ly/2GohMvw.

  • Through their interviews, the authors determine that civic innovation is not just a “compilation of projects” but that it can inspire institutional structural change.
  • Civic innovation projects that have a “technology focus can sound very different than process-related innovations”; however the outcomes are actually quite similar as they disrupt how citizens and government engage with one another.
  • Technology is viewed by some of the experts as an enabler of civic innovation – not necessarily the driver for innovation itself. What constitutes innovation is how new tools are implemented by government or by civic groups that changes the governing dynamic.

Patel, Mayur, Jon Sotsky, Sean Gourley, and Daniel Houghton. “Knight Foundation Report on Civic Technology.” Presentation. Knight Foundation, December 2013. http://slidesha.re/11UYgO0.

  • This reports aims to advance the field of civic technology, which compared to the tech industry as a whole is relatively young. It maps the field, creating a starting place for understanding activity and investment in the sector.
  • It defines two themes, Open Government and Civic Action, and identifies 11 clusters of civic tech innovation that fall into the two themes. For each cluster, the authors describe the type of activities and highlights specific organizations.
  • The report identified more than $430 million of private and philanthropic investment directed to 102 civic tech organizations from January 2011 to May 2013.

Open Plans. “Field Scan on Civic Technology.” Living Cities, November 2012. http://bit.ly/1HGjGih.

  • Commissioned by Living Cities and authored by Open Plans, the Field Scan investigates the emergent field of civic technology and generates the first analysis of the potential impact for the field as well as a critique for how tools and new methods need to be more inclusive of low-income communities in their use and implementation.
  • Respondents generally agreed that the tools developed and in use in cities so far are demonstrations of the potential power of civic tech, but that these tools don’t yet go far enough.
  • Civic tech tools have the potential to improve the lives of low-income people in a number of ways. However, these tools often fail to reach the population they are intended to benefit. To better understand this challenge, civic tech for low-income people must be considered in the broader context of their interactions with technology and with government.
  • Although hackathons are popular, their approach to problem solving is not always driven by community needs, and hackathons often do not produce useful material for governments or citizens in need.

Goldberg, Jeremy M. “Riding the Second Wave of Civic Innovation.” Governing, August 28, 2014. http://bit.ly/1vOKnhJ.

  • In this piece, Goldberg argues that innovation and entrepreneurship in local government increasingly require mobilizing talent from many sectors and skill sets.

Black, Alissa, and Burstein, Rachel. “A Guide for Making Innovation Offices Work.” IBM Center for the Business of Government, October 2014. http://bit.ly/1vOFZP4.

  • In this report, Burstein and Black examine the recent trend toward the creation of innovation offices across the nation at all levels of government to understand the structural models now being used to stimulate innovation—both internally within an agency, and externally for the agency’s partners and communities.
  • The authors conducted interviews with leadership of innovation offices of cities that include Philadelphia, Austin, Kansas City, Chicago, Davis, Memphis and Los Angeles.
  • The report cites examples of offices, generates a typology for the field, links to projects and highlights success factors.

Mulholland, Jessica, and Noelle Knell. “Chief Innovation Officers in State and Local Government (Interactive Map).” Government Technology, March 28, 2014. http://bit.ly/1ycArvX.

  • This article provides an overview of how different cities structure their Chief Innovation Officer positions and provides links to offices, projects and additional editorial content.
  • Some innovation officers find their duties merged with traditional CIO responsibilities, as is the case in Chicago, Philadelphia and New York City. Others, like those in Louisville and Nashville, have titles that reveal a link to their jurisdiction’s economic development endeavors.

Toolkits

Bloomberg Philanthropies. January 2014. “Transform Your City through Innovation: The Innovation Delivery Model for Making It Happen.” New York: Bloomberg Philanthropies. http://bloombg.org/120VrKB.

  • In 2011, Bloomberg Philanthropies funded a three-year innovation capacity program in five major United States cities— Atlanta, Chicago, Louisville, Memphis, and New Orleans – in which cities could hire top-level staff to develop and see through the implementation of solutions to top mayoral priorities such as customer service, murder, homelessness, and economic development, using a sequence of steps.
  • The Innovation Delivery Team Playbook describes the Innovation Delivery Model and describes each aspect of the model from how to hire and structure the team, to how to manage roundtables and run competitions.

Do-It-Yourself Democracy: The Rise of the Public Engagement Industry


New book by Caroline W. Lee: “Citizen participation has undergone a radical shift since anxieties about “bowling alone” seized the nation in the 1990s. Many pundits and observers have cheered America’s twenty-first century civic renaissance-an explosion of participatory innovations in public life. Invitations to “have your say!” and “join the discussion!” have proliferated. But has the widespread enthusiasm for maximizing citizen democracy led to real change?
In Do-It-Yourself Democracy, sociologist Caroline W. Lee examines how participatory innovations have reshaped American civic life over the past two decades. Lee looks at the public engagement industry that emerged to serve government, corporate, and nonprofit clients seeking to gain a handle on the increasingly noisy demands of their constituents and stakeholders. The beneficiaries of new forms of democratic empowerment are not only humble citizens, but also the engagement experts who host the forums. Does it matter if the folks deepening democracy are making money at it? How do they make sense of the contradictions inherent in their roles?
In investigating public engagement practitioners’ everyday anxieties and larger worldviews, we see reflected the strange meaning of power in contemporary institutions. New technologies and deliberative practices have democratized the ways in which organizations operate, but Lee argues that they have also been marketed and sold as tools to facilitate cost-cutting, profitability, and other management goals – and that public deliberation has burdened everyday people with new responsibilities without delivering on its promises of empowerment….”

Restoring Confidence in Open, Shared and Personal Data


Report of the UK Digital Government Review: “It is obvious that government needs to be able to use data both to deliver services and to present information to public view. How else would government know which bank account to place a pension payment into, or a citizen know the results of an election or how to contact their elected representatives?

As more and more data is created, preserved and shared in ever-increasing volumes a number of urgent questions are begged: over opportunities and hazards; over the importance of using best-practice techniques, insights and technologies developed in the private sector, academia and elsewhere; over the promises and limitations of openness; and how all this might be articulated and made accessible to the public.

Government has already adopted “open data” (we will discuss this more in the next section) and there are now increasing calls for government to pay more attention to data analytics and so-called “big data” – although the first faltering steps to unlock benefits, here, have often ended in the discovery that using large-scale data is a far more nuanced business than was initially assumed

Debates around government and data have often been extremely high-profile – the NHS care.data [27] debate was raging while this review was in progress – but they are also shrouded in terms that can generate confusion and complexities that are not easily summarized.

In this chapter we will unpick some of these terms and some parts of the debate. This is a detailed and complex area and there is much more that could have been included [28]. This is not an area that can easily be summarized into a simple bullet-pointed list of policies.

Smarter Than Us: The Rise of Machine Intelligence


 

Book by Stuart Armstrong at the Machine Intelligence Research Institute: “What happens when machines become smarter than humans? Forget lumbering Terminators. The power of an artificial intelligence (AI) comes from its intelligence, not physical strength and laser guns. Humans steer the future not because we’re the strongest or the fastest but because we’re the smartest. When machines become smarter than humans, we’ll be handing them the steering wheel. What promises—and perils—will these powerful machines present? Stuart Armstrong’s new book navigates these questions with clarity and wit.
Can we instruct AIs to steer the future as we desire? What goals should we program into them? It turns out this question is difficult to answer! Philosophers have tried for thousands of years to define an ideal world, but there remains no consensus. The prospect of goal-driven, smarter-than-human AI gives moral philosophy a new urgency. The future could be filled with joy, art, compassion, and beings living worthwhile and wonderful lives—but only if we’re able to precisely define what a “good” world is, and skilled enough to describe it perfectly to a computer program.
AIs, like computers, will do what we say—which is not necessarily what we mean. Such precision requires encoding the entire system of human values for an AI: explaining them to a mind that is alien to us, defining every ambiguous term, clarifying every edge case. Moreover, our values are fragile: in some cases, if we mis-define a single piece of the puzzle—say, consciousness—we end up with roughly 0% of the value we intended to reap, instead of 99% of the value.
Though an understanding of the problem is only beginning to spread, researchers from fields ranging from philosophy to computer science to economics are working together to conceive and test solutions. Are we up to the challenge?

Activists Wield Search Data to Challenge and Change Police Policy


at the New York Times: “One month after a Latino youth died from a gunshot as he sat handcuffed in the back of a police cruiser here last year, 150 demonstrators converged on Police Headquarters, some shouting “murderers” as baton-wielding officers in riot gear fired tear gas.

The police say the youth shot himself with a hidden gun. But to many residents of this city, which is 40 percent black, the incident fit a pattern of abuse and bias against minorities that includes frequent searches of cars and use of excessive force. In one case, a black female Navy veteran said she was beaten by an officer after telling a friend she was visiting that the friend did not have to let the police search her home.

Yet if it sounds as if Durham might have become a harbinger of Ferguson, Mo. — where the fatal shooting of an unarmed black teenager by a white police officer led to weeks of protests this summer — things took a very different turn. Rather than relying on demonstrations to force change, a coalition of ministers, lawyers and community and political activists turned instead to numbers. They used an analysis of state data from 2002 to 2013 that showed that the Durham police searched black male motorists at more than twice the rate of white males during stops. Drugs and other illicit materials were found no more often on blacks….

The use of statistics is gaining traction not only in North Carolina, where data on police stops is collected under a 15-year-old law, but in other cities around the country.

Austin, Tex., began requiring written consent for searches without probable cause two years ago, after its independent police monitor reported that whites stopped by the police were searched one in every 28 times, while blacks were searched one in eight times.

In Kalamazoo, Mich., a city-funded study last year found that black drivers were nearly twice as likely to be stopped, and then “much more likely to be asked to exit their vehicle, to be handcuffed, searched and arrested.”

As a result, Jeff Hadley, the public safety chief of Kalamazoo, imposed new rules requiring officers to explain to supervisors what “reasonable suspicion” they had each time they sought a driver’s consent to a search. Traffic stops have declined 42 percent amid a drop of more than 7 percent in the crime rate, he said.

“It really stops the fishing expeditions,” Chief Hadley said of the new rules. Though the findings demoralized his officers, he said, the reaction from the African-American community stunned him. “I thought they would be up in arms, but they said: ‘You’re not telling us anything we didn’t already know. How can we help?’ ”

The School of Government at the University of North Carolina at Chapel Hill has a new manual for defense lawyers, prosecutors and judges, with a chapter that shows how stop and search data can be used by the defense to raise challenges in cases where race may have played a role…”
